Wind and solar hybrid systems integrate wind turbines and solar photovoltaic (PV) panels to generate electricity. By combining these two renewable sources, these systems can provide a more consistent and reliable power supply compared to standalone systems. Solar energy typically peaks during daylight hours, while wind energy can be harnessed both day and night, depending on local conditions. This complementary nature enhances the overall efficiency and stability of the energy supply.

Several factors contribute to the growth of the wind and solar hybrid systems market:
Rising Demand for Clean Energy: Growing environmental concerns and the need to reduce carbon footprints have led to a surge in demand for renewable energy sources. Hybrid systems offer a sustainable alternative to fossil fuels, aligning with global sustainability goals.
Government Incentives and Policies: Many governments worldwide are implementing favorable policies and incentives to encourage the adoption of renewable energy technologies. These include subsidies, tax benefits, and favorable regulatory frameworks that make hybrid systems more attractive to investors and consumers.
Technological Advancements: Continuous improvements in wind turbine and solar panel technologies have enhanced the efficiency and cost-effectiveness of hybrid systems. Innovations in energy storage solutions further complement these advancements, enabling better energy management.
Energy Security and Reliability: Hybrid systems provide a more stable and reliable power supply, especially in remote or off-grid areas. This reliability is crucial for industries and communities seeking uninterrupted energy access.
The wind and solar hybrid systems market can be segmented based on product type, power rating, and end-user applications:
Product Type:
Stand-Alone Systems: These systems operate independently of the grid, making them ideal for remote locations and off-grid applications. They accounted for over 60% of the global market share in 2019 and are expected to maintain dominance due to the increasing number of off-grid industries.
On-Grid Systems: Connected to the main power grid, these systems allow for the export of excess energy, providing economic benefits to users and contributing to grid stability.
Power Rating:
Up to 10 kW: Suitable for residential applications, these systems cater to small households seeking to reduce energy costs and carbon footprints.
11 kW–100 kW: Ideal for commercial establishments, these systems balance cost and energy output, making them popular among businesses aiming for sustainability.
Above 100 kW: Targeted at industrial applications, these high-capacity systems meet the substantial energy demands of large-scale operations.
End-User Applications:
Residential: Homeowners are increasingly adopting hybrid systems to achieve energy independence and reduce utility bills.
Commercial: Businesses are investing in hybrid systems to enhance sustainability credentials and achieve long-term cost savings.
Industrial: Industries require reliable and uninterrupted power supplies, making hybrid systems a viable solution for critical operations.

Despite the promising outlook, several challenges hinder the widespread adoption of wind and solar hybrid systems:
High Initial Investment: The upfront costs associated with installing hybrid systems can be substantial, posing a barrier for many potential users.
Intermittency Issues: While hybrid systems mitigate intermittency to some extent, they still face challenges related to weather variability, which can affect energy production.
Grid Integration: Integrating hybrid systems into existing power grids requires significant infrastructure upgrades and can be complex, especially in regions with outdated grid systems.
